In summary
University Hospital & Queen's Road is in the most-deprived 10–20% of England, ranked #6,113 of 6,856 neighbourhoods nationally, and #43 of 45 in Croydon. Across the seven themes it scores highest on Education (32) and lowest on Income (7). Typical homes here sold for about £286,500 over the past year, down 10% across five years (from 53 sales), 33% below the wider Croydon median of £425,000.
